Hiked Moosiluake on 11/25/06 to burn off some Thanksgiving calories. Trail conditions very good, only very small patches of ice, not much mud either. One large blow down. Gorge brook, snapper, carraige road, gorge brook. Nothing exceptional except for the exceptionally clear and blue sky. A real blue bird day as my friend Brian says. We arrived at the trail head early (someone was parked seemingly overnight in the middle of the turnaround...) and summitted with a very quick time of 2 hours. It was so warm and pleasant on top and the views were so spectacular that we ended up staying on the summit for 1.5 hrs. and could have easily dozed off for a nice nap. The last time I was on Moosilauke exactly one year ago it was cold, cloudy, and so windy we had to shelter laying down behind the old foundation. When we got down to the lodge there were more cars then I have ever seen there. Standard hike but this day will stand out due to the beautiful late fall conditions.
